WebFeb 28, 2024 · In cultures with a high uncertainty avoidance, individuals are typically surrounded by strict rules and social obligations. They are less tolerant of uncertainty and … WebMay 7, 2024 · In a high UAI culture, there is an emotional need for rules, people may have an inner urge to be busy and work hard, precision and punctuality are the norm.

WebMay 19, 2024 · A high scoring UAI culture encourages people to work hard and be productive since the future is unknown, and therefore there is more productivity in such an environment. Both Russia and Saudi Arabia cultures score high on UAI since, in both cultures, hard work is praised, and people generally have the urge to keep busy.
